Output eb9c8041d410a2e76811d9acad15cd5927b6f5117242e5fc711a7aba3b0b1a90:64

value
1818457
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a32fc5ef54e565dfbb97f9ac09de8a0657023dc OP_EQUAL
address
3EHkFaDXKo9DBqLkBo5qsgxgF4Uf7v5Vq1
transaction
eb9c8041d410a2e76811d9acad15cd5927b6f5117242e5fc711a7aba3b0b1a90
confirmations
229406
spent
true